Overhead Galvanized Steel Strand

Product Detail

Galvanized steel strands for overhead optical cables for power communication and telecommunications are steel products made by twisting multiple galvanized steel wires together.

Features

Anti-corrosion: Hot-dip galvanizing is used to achieve good anti-corrosion performance.

Good stability: During use, the structure is stable and not prone to deformation or loosening.

High strength: It has high tensile strength and can withstand large tensile forces, wires, reinforcing cores and other parts that need to withstand large tensile forces.

Classification

According to the cross-sectional structure: 1×3, 1×7, and 1×19 are commonly used.

According to the nominal tensile strength: 1175MPa, 1270MPa, 1370MPa, .

According to the level of the zinc layer of the steel wire: A, B, and C.

Functional use

Overhead Galvanized Steel Strand is widely used in the laying of overhead optical cables for telecommunications and communications to support optical cables, wires for power or railway poles, wires for agricultural fruit greenhouses, and wire mesh for guardrails.
